Runbook — Score sheet transfer, Vestermoor Regional Chess Final. The arbiter's sealed envelope contains all original score sheets and the signed results ledger. Driver collects from the Aldenhal Community Hall back office no later than 21:30 and delivers directly to the Federation records room at Quenby House. No intermediate stops; the envelope stays in the cab. On delivery, the receiving clerk will only accept the envelope against this phrase:

courier memo of yawep-yafog: the pramir ulaix courier leaves the ulavan aldix frair zorok oliiel joreth rusdor fenvan ledger at gate 1305 under passcode 514738

Subject: Ledger key rotation — Glypha encoding service

Welcome aboard, all. We rotated the credential for Glypha, the internal service that detects encodings on uploaded text files before ingestion. The old key stops working Friday. Update your local config and restart the detector worker; no other changes are needed. If uploads start failing with auth errors, you missed a config. The new key is below.

API key for tagef-fafop: vxb2-ta

## Break-Glass Access: Lingua-Extract Script

The Lingua-Extract script pulls translation strings from the Quillfort monorepo and pushes them to the localization vault. Routine runs use a scoped service account. If that account is disabled during an incident, break-glass access is permitted only with incident-commander approval, and every use is logged for review. To initiate break-glass mode, the operator enters the recovery passphrase shown below.

vault phrase of tajop-haduf = holath-brivan-wenax